At Architecture and Concept within the Software and Electronics unit, we define the overall system level architecture and concepts for the distributed software and electronics platform, including diagnostics and software applications.
We are part of shaping Volvo Cars’ next generation software and electronics platform and create the foundation for a centralized computing system-enabling safe, secure, and scalable software driven functions across our future vehicles. By developing a high performance, multi node architecture built on advanced systems-on-chip, we provide a powerful platform for teams and partners to innovate and deploy the features that will define the cars of tomorrow.

The Volvo Group is one of the world’s leading manufacturers of trucks, buses, construction equipment and marine and industrial engines. The Group also provides complete solutions for financing and service. The Volvo Group, with its headquarters in Gothenburg, employs about 100,000 people, has production facilities in 18 countries and sells its products in more than 190 markets.
